Find Help - Help for People with Disabilities

Central Coast Center for Independent Living
318 Cayuga Street, Suite 208, Salinas 93901
Phone: 831-757-2968 / Fax: 831-757-5549 / TDD Phone: 831-757-3949
Website:
www.cccil.org

Promotes the independence of people with disabilities by supporting their equal and full participation in community life. CCCIL provides advocacy, education and support to people with all disabilities, their families and the community.

Gateway Center of Monterey County, Inc
850 Congress Avenue, Pacific Grove 93950
Phone: 831-372-8002 / Fax: 831-372-2411
Email:
info@gatewaycenter.org
Website:
www.gatewaycenter.org

Provides long-term and respite residential care to developmentally disabled adults as well as Supported Living Services. Day programs include training, recreation, education, and community access for developmentally disabled adults. Transportation is provided.

Hope Services
1663 Catalina Street, Sand City 93955
Phone: 831-393-1575 / Fax: 831-393-0879
Website:
www.hopeservices.org

Employment training, community employment, independent living skills and day activity programs assisting individuals with developmental disabilities to live and participate in their communities.

Interim, Inc.
P.O. Box 3222, Monterey 93942
Phone: 831-649-4522
Website:
www.interiminc.org

Affordable housing and supportive services for adults with psychiatric disabilities. Services include crisis intervention, supportive permanent housing, homeless supportive transitional housing, dual diagnosis treatment program, supported education and employment services, homeless outreach and emergency housing, family outreach and social support groups.
